Overview of the Situation

Elon Musk’s AI company, xAI, has failed to meet a self-imposed deadline to finalize its AI safety framework. This lapse has drawn criticism from watchdog groups like The Midas Project, which point out that xAI’s commitment to safety is questionable. The company previously released a draft framework at the AI Seoul Summit, but it lacked clarity on important safety measures and only applied to future models, not those currently in development.

Key Points to Note

  • xAI’s chatbot, Grok, has been criticized for inappropriate behavior, such as undressing photos of women and using profanity.
  • The draft safety framework, published in February, was vague and did not specify how risks would be managed.
  • xAI promised to release a revised safety policy by May 10, but this deadline passed without any updates.
  • A report from SaferAI ranked xAI poorly in terms of risk management compared to other AI labs, highlighting its weak safety practices.
